Dallas Ice Jets rips Tulsa Jr. Oilers, 5-1Oilers Ice Center Fri, Mar 07, 2014 Story by Narrative Science.
Dallas Ice Jets had a three-goal lead after two periods and cruised the rest of the way en route to a 5-1 win over Tulsa Jr. Oilers. Dallas Ice Jets was sparked by Matthew Heim, who registered one goal and one assist. Heim scored 59 seconds into the second period to make the score 2-0 Dallas Ice Jets. James Bohan provided the assist. Dallas Ice Jets kept Tulsa Jr. Oilers' goalie busy throughout the game, and Adam Salisbury made 70 saves on 75 shots. Dallas Ice Jets also had goals scored by Yannick Aube, who had two and Johnny Henson and Alex Devillier, who scored one goal each. Other players who recorded assists for Dallas Ice Jets were Chris Schutz, who had three and Scott Folden, Byron Carlisle, and Nick Felan, who contributed one a piece. Tulsa Jr. Oilers did not challenge the opposing netminder, only getting 11 shots on net to force 10 saves. Tulsa Jr. Oilers was led by Keiran Spettie, who scored the team's only goal. Spettie scored short handed 6:22 into the second period to make the score 3-1 Dallas Ice Jets. Tulsa Jr. Oilers played down a man on Trevor Ruiz's interference. Dallas Ice Jets' Vladyslav Slyusarchuk stopped 10 shots out of the 11 that he faced. Dallas Ice Jets incurred four minutes in penalty time with two minors. Tulsa Jr. Oilers incurred 10 minutes in penalty time with five minors.
